Cold Weather Can Reduce Efficiency and Strain Components
Cold temperatures have a direct impact on your car’s engine and battery performance. Engines take longer to reach optimal operating temperature, which can reduce fuel efficiency during short trips. At the same time, cold weather thickens engine oil, making it harder for components to move smoothly. This added resistance can increase wear over time.
Your battery is especially vulnerable in low temperatures. Chemical reactions inside the battery slow down in the cold, reducing its ability to hold a charge. This is why cars are more likely to have starting issues in winter. If your battery is already weak, cold weather can cause it to fail unexpectedly. Regular checks can help prevent being stranded.
Tire pressure also drops as temperatures fall, which affects traction and handling. Underinflated tires create more rolling resistance, reducing fuel efficiency. They also wear unevenly, which shortens their lifespan. Monitoring tire pressure during colder months is essential for maintaining performance. It’s a simple step that can improve both safety and efficiency.
Hot Weather Can Lead to Overheating and Increased Wear
High temperatures can put stress on your car’s cooling system and engine components. Engines generate a lot of heat on their own, and hot weather makes it harder to dissipate that heat effectively. If the cooling system isn’t working properly, overheating can occur quickly. This can lead to serious engine damage if not addressed.
Fluids also behave differently in hot conditions. Engine oil can thin out at high temperatures, reducing its ability to lubricate moving parts. Coolant levels must be properly maintained to prevent overheating. Even transmission fluid can degrade faster in extreme heat. Keeping an eye on fluid levels helps protect your vehicle from unnecessary damage. Using manufacturer-recommended fluids ensures better performance. Regular fluid changes can also extend component life.
Heat can also affect your tires and interior components. Higher temperatures increase tire pressure, which can raise the risk of blowouts if not monitored. Inside the car, materials like dashboards and seats can deteriorate faster under constant heat exposure. Using sunshades and parking in shaded areas can help reduce these effects. These small actions can extend the life of your vehicle.
Rain and Moisture Impact Traction and Visibility
Wet conditions reduce tire grip on the road, making it easier to lose control of your vehicle. Water creates a layer between the tires and the pavement, which can lead to hydroplaning at higher speeds. Maintaining proper tire tread depth helps improve traction in these situations. Slowing down during rain also reduces risk significantly. These adjustments make driving safer in wet conditions.
Moisture can also affect braking performance and visibility. Wet brake components may not respond as quickly, especially during the first few uses after driving through water. Windshield visibility can decrease due to rain, fog, or condensation. Functional wipers and proper defogging systems are essential in these conditions. Keeping them in good shape ensures safer driving. Replacing worn wiper blades improves clarity. Clean glass surfaces also enhance visibility.
Long-term exposure to moisture can lead to rust and corrosion. Metal components, especially under the vehicle, are particularly vulnerable. Over time, this can weaken structural parts and lead to costly repairs. Regular cleaning and protective treatments can help reduce corrosion. Preventive care makes a noticeable difference over time. Applying protective coatings can slow rust formation. Routine inspections help catch early signs of damage.
